diff --git a/fs/btrfs/ioctl.c b/fs/btrfs/ioctl.c index b21558bb12943cce36c416da1f72bf1168c44644..ae8fbf9d3de2ad0028ba2b1f5af81d4f3028f4ea 100644 --- a/fs/btrfs/ioctl.c +++ b/fs/btrfs/ioctl.c @@ -2169,9 +2169,6 @@ static noinline int btrfs_ioctl_tree_search_v2(struct file *file, buf_size = args.buf_size; - if (buf_size < sizeof(struct btrfs_ioctl_search_header)) - return -EOVERFLOW; - /* limit result size to 16MB */ if (buf_size > buf_limit) buf_size = buf_limit;